We’re looking for a detail‑oriented Accounts Payable Analyst to support the day‑to‑day delivery of our accounts payable function. This role plays a key part in ensuring supplier invoices are accurately processed and paid on time, while maintaining strong internal and external relationships.
You’ll help ensure our suppliers are paid accurately and on time, supporting business continuity and maintaining trusted partnerships. This role also strengthens financial controls by ensuring processes, approvals and policies are consistently followed.    
 

Responsibilities

~1 min read

Compile and process invoices owed to suppliers and other organisations
Validate supplier invoices against purchase orders to ensure accuracy Perform invoice to PO matching, ensuring approvals and procedures are followed
Verify purchase order details and interpret Levels of Authority
Maintain accurate invoice and transaction records
 Review vendor statements and investigate discrepancies
Work directly with vendors and internal stakeholders on queries, past due balances and reconciliations
Process payments via EFT
Support credit card administration and reconciliations
Identify and escalate issues or process gaps to improve efficiency and compliance

Wesco Anixter represents the international go‑to‑market brand of Wesco, enabling us to combine the scale and resources of a global company with strong local knowledge and in‑country expertise.

In Australia, we operate security branches across 10 locations, featuring showrooms, trade counters and warehouse facilities that enable us to be a leading distributor of security equipment.  We employ over 170 staff and partner with the world’s top brands to deliver security technology solutions across access control, CCTV, alarms, monitoring, and systems integration.

Across ANZ, our footprint spans commercial sales and services for security, networking, datacom and telecom product solutions, as well as a manufacturer of unified video, access and security systems. This role sits within Wesco Anixter Security Branches (previously Central Security Distribution).
